University of Minnesota Rochester: Chair of the Center for Learning Innovation

The University of Minnesota Rochester (UMR) seeks a collaborative, innovative, and adaptable leader to serve as the Faculty Chair of the Center for Learning Innovation (CLI), the sole, interdisciplinary undergraduate department at UMR. The Chair, who reports to the Vice Chancellor for Academic Affairs and Innovation (VCAAI), is responsible for providing strategic leadership and administrative oversight for all internal aspects of the CLI. This is a 12-month, full-time administrative position that requires a commitment to interdisciplinary collaboration and an understanding of and deep commitment to UMR's unique educational model. The Chair has direct oversight of all CLI faculty (currently numbering 45, but growing rapidly), serving as the primary point of contact for their professional and academic needs and as a liaison to University leadership. This role offers a unique opportunity to contribute to the growth and success of a vibrant academic community while leading a team dedicated to innovation in learning and teaching and to creating positive change in higher education.
The initial term of the Chair is 4 years, and renewable. Upon stepping down from this position, the chair will become a member of the CLI.

This position works in-person in Rochester, MN. This role is not eligible for H-1B or Green Card sponsorship.

Responsibilities:
Administrative Duties (25%)

1. Oversee academic budgets
2. Collaborate with relevant campus entities to oversee course scheduling and other periodic logistical needs
3. Coordinate with faculty leaders to prepare for and facilitate regular CLI meetings
4. Monitor CLI committees in cooperation with Committee on Committees
5. Represent unit on University of Minnesota system committees when appropriate
6. Collaborate with VCAAI to lead accreditation processes and other initiatives when appropriate
7. Oversee and support the efforts of various faculty directors and direct reports, including faculty development, writing, and first-year seminars.

Faculty Affairs (25%)

8. Provide faculty mentoring and guidance in teaching and research to CLI faculty from a range of disciplines
9. Consult with faculty Directorship Committee (DC) on faculty workload, scheduling, and pay equity issues
10. Along with the DC, serve as liaison and advocate for the faculty to the administration
11. Collaborate with VCAAI and Director of Academic Affairs (DAA) to develop and implement appropriate hiring plans
12. Review and advise on Faculty Annual Reviews, Promotion and Tenure. Serve on Student Based Faculty (SBF) Annual Review Committee
13. Approve Faculty Leaves and Sabbaticals
14. Support faculty professional development initiatives in collaboration with VCAAI and Director of Faculty Development
15. Lead faculty conflict resolution as needed

Curriculum (15%)

16. Collaborate with VCAAI, the Director for Academic Affairs, and others in developing and implementing vision for academic initiatives at UMR
17. Serve as ex-officio member of Curriculum Committee
18. Ensure the quality of academic programs, including conducting regular assessments and implementing improvements as needed
19. Oversee course and classroom scheduling in collaboration with DAA, Academic Programs Administrative Associate, and facilities management staff

Student Affairs (10%)

20. Serve as member of the Student Conduct Team to address issues of academic integrity
21. Mediate and resolve student academic grievances and complaints
22. As needed, meet with student government representatives regarding curricular questions and policy

Teaching and/or Research (25%)

23. In annual collaboration with VCAAI, the Chair will determine a research and teaching agenda that meets their personal and professional goals, supports the needs of the CLI, and allows for a rich and fulfilling professional life. Teaching expectations will never exceed the equivalent of two 3-credit courses per academic year.


Qualifications

Minimum Qualifications:

24. PhD in any discipline appropriate to the academic focus of UMR or equivalent terminal degree
25. At least 4 years of experience in academic leadership
26. Rank of Associate Professor or the credentials necessary to be hired at that level
27. Proven track record of research in educational practices and higher education (Curriculum and Instruction, Education Research, SOTL or DBER)

Preferred Qualifications:

28. Rank of Full Professor or the credentials necessary to be hired at that level
29. Demonstrated record of success leading change and innovation in a department of notable size, complexity, or significance
30. Demonstrated ability to lead and motivate faculty and staff
31. Proficiency in collecting, managing, and using data to inform academic decisions
32. Demonstrated commitment to UMR’s vision and values: human potential, diversity and inclusivity, community, evidence-based decision-making, and respect.
33. Experience working in multidisciplinary environments
34. A record of excellence in classroom instruction
35. Experience with budget management and resource allocation
36. Excellent interpersonal and communication skills
37. Experience in accreditation processes and compliance
38. Demonstrated success in faculty development and management
39. Experience in curriculum development and assessment
40. Experience managing courses, including scheduling and sequencing
41. Experience with strategic planning in higher education
42. Strong analytical and decision-making skills

Pay and Benefits

Pay Range: $80,000 - $95,000 annually, depending on education/qualifications/experience

Time Appointment: 100%Appointment

Position Type: Faculty and P&A Staff
